Activity log for bug #1982332

Date Who What changed Old value New value Message
2022-07-20 11:29:23 bugproxy bug added bug
2022-07-20 11:29:25 bugproxy tags architecture-s39064 bugnameltc-199023 severity-high targetmilestone-inin2210
2022-07-20 11:29:27 bugproxy ubuntu: assignee Skipper Bug Screeners (skipper-screen-team)
2022-07-20 11:29:29 bugproxy affects ubuntu linux (Ubuntu)
2022-07-20 11:29:30 bugproxy bug added subscriber CDE Administration
2022-07-20 11:29:31 bugproxy bug added subscriber Boris Barth
2022-07-20 12:29:56 Frank Heimes affects linux (Ubuntu) qclib (Ubuntu)
2022-07-20 12:30:08 Frank Heimes bug task added ubuntu-z-systems
2022-07-20 12:30:28 Frank Heimes ubuntu-z-systems: assignee Skipper Bug Screeners (skipper-screen-team)
2022-07-20 12:30:33 Frank Heimes qclib (Ubuntu): assignee Skipper Bug Screeners (skipper-screen-team) Frank Heimes (fheimes)
2022-07-20 12:30:37 Frank Heimes qclib (Ubuntu): importance Undecided High
2022-07-20 12:30:40 Frank Heimes ubuntu-z-systems: importance Undecided High
2022-07-20 12:30:44 Frank Heimes qclib (Ubuntu): status New In Progress
2022-07-20 12:30:47 Frank Heimes ubuntu-z-systems: status New In Progress
2022-07-20 13:36:30 Frank Heimes attachment added debdiff_qclib_kinetic_2.3.0-0ubuntu1_to_2.3.1-0ubuntu1.diff https://bugs.launchpad.net/ubuntu-z-systems/+bug/1982332/+attachment/5604361/+files/debdiff_qclib_kinetic_2.3.0-0ubuntu1_to_2.3.1-0ubuntu1.diff
2022-07-20 13:36:43 Frank Heimes qclib (Ubuntu): assignee Frank Heimes (fheimes)
2022-07-20 13:37:03 Frank Heimes bug added subscriber Ubuntu Sponsors Team
2022-07-20 13:49:40 Frank Heimes tags architecture-s39064 bugnameltc-199023 severity-high targetmilestone-inin2210 architecture-s39064 bugnameltc-199023 kinetic severity-high targetmilestone-inin2210
2022-07-20 19:14:27 Frank Heimes attachment added debdiff_qclib_jammy_2.3.0-0ubuntu1_to_2.3.0-0ubuntu1.1.diff https://bugs.launchpad.net/ubuntu-z-systems/+bug/1982332/+attachment/5604439/+files/debdiff_qclib_jammy_2.3.0-0ubuntu1_to_2.3.0-0ubuntu1.1.diff
2022-07-20 19:14:57 Frank Heimes nominated for series Ubuntu Jammy
2022-07-20 19:14:57 Frank Heimes bug task added qclib (Ubuntu Jammy)
2022-07-20 19:14:57 Frank Heimes nominated for series Ubuntu Kinetic
2022-07-20 19:14:57 Frank Heimes bug task added qclib (Ubuntu Kinetic)
2022-07-20 19:15:04 Frank Heimes qclib (Ubuntu Jammy): importance Undecided High
2022-07-20 19:15:08 Frank Heimes qclib (Ubuntu Jammy): status New In Progress
2022-07-20 19:15:13 Frank Heimes information type Private Public
2022-07-20 20:16:00 Frank Heimes description Add support for new IBM Z Hardware in qclib SRU Justification: ================== [Impact] * This is a hardware enablement SRU that adds support for IBM z16. * It just adds a single code line to the qc_mtype struct that maps from type '3931' to the (real) IBM zSystems name 'IBM z16'. [Test Plan] * Install an Ubuntu 22.04 or 22.10 daily on an IBM z16 LPAR, z/VM guest or KVM vm and install the qclib test package: sudo apt install qclib-test that will also pull in libqc2, too. * Then execute the test program 'qc_test' and look for the qc_type_name. The updated package will be able to identify 'IBM z16' like this: $ qc_test | grep qc_type_name qc_type_name [S ]: IBM z16 [Where problems could occur] * Problems can occur in case the type '3931' is not the correct one for IBM z16, * the qc_type_name is not correct, * or the qc_mtype struct is not expanded correctly. * All this can be verified by either a test build, available here: https://launchpad.net/~fheimes/+archive/ubuntu/lp1982332/+packages or by the test described above: qc_test | grep -B 1 qc_type_name [Other Info] * Even if the title only talks about 22.10 it is very useful to have that hardware enablement patch in 22.04 as well, since 22.04 is the first Ubuntu Server release with IBM z16 support. __________ Add support for new IBM Z Hardware in qclib
2022-07-20 20:17:45 Frank Heimes description SRU Justification: ================== [Impact] * This is a hardware enablement SRU that adds support for IBM z16. * It just adds a single code line to the qc_mtype struct that maps from type '3931' to the (real) IBM zSystems name 'IBM z16'. [Test Plan] * Install an Ubuntu 22.04 or 22.10 daily on an IBM z16 LPAR, z/VM guest or KVM vm and install the qclib test package: sudo apt install qclib-test that will also pull in libqc2, too. * Then execute the test program 'qc_test' and look for the qc_type_name. The updated package will be able to identify 'IBM z16' like this: $ qc_test | grep qc_type_name qc_type_name [S ]: IBM z16 [Where problems could occur] * Problems can occur in case the type '3931' is not the correct one for IBM z16, * the qc_type_name is not correct, * or the qc_mtype struct is not expanded correctly. * All this can be verified by either a test build, available here: https://launchpad.net/~fheimes/+archive/ubuntu/lp1982332/+packages or by the test described above: qc_test | grep -B 1 qc_type_name [Other Info] * Even if the title only talks about 22.10 it is very useful to have that hardware enablement patch in 22.04 as well, since 22.04 is the first Ubuntu Server release with IBM z16 support. __________ Add support for new IBM Z Hardware in qclib SRU Justification: ================== [Impact]  * This is a hardware enablement SRU that adds support for IBM z16.  * It just adds a single code line to the qc_mtype struct    that maps from type '3931' to the (real) IBM zSystems name 'IBM z16'. [Test Plan]  * Install an Ubuntu 22.04 or 22.10 daily on an IBM z16 LPAR, z/VM guest    or KVM vm and install the qclib test package:    sudo apt install qclib-test    that will also pull in libqc2, too.  * Then execute the test program 'qc_test' and look for the qc_type_name.    The updated package will be able to identify 'IBM z16' like this:    $ qc_test | grep qc_type_name                           qc_type_name [S ]: IBM z16 [Where problems could occur]  * Problems can occur in case the type '3931' is not the correct    one for IBM z16,  * the qc_type_name is not correct,  * or the qc_mtype struct is not expanded correctly.  * All this can be verified by either a test build, available here:    https://launchpad.net/~fheimes/+archive/ubuntu/lp1982332/+packages    or by the test described above:    qc_test | grep -B 1 qc_type_name [Other Info]  * Even if only 22.10 is mentioned in the title, it is very useful to have that hardware enablement patch in 22.04 as well,    since 22.04 is the first Ubuntu Server release with IBM z16 support. __________ Add support for new IBM Z Hardware in qclib
2022-07-20 20:17:54 Frank Heimes tags architecture-s39064 bugnameltc-199023 kinetic severity-high targetmilestone-inin2210 architecture-s39064 bugnameltc-199023 jammy kinetic severity-high targetmilestone-inin2210
2022-07-26 07:23:53 Lukas Märdian removed subscriber Ubuntu Sponsors Team
2022-07-26 10:56:55 Launchpad Janitor qclib (Ubuntu Kinetic): status In Progress Fix Released
2022-08-19 17:22:19 Brian Murray qclib (Ubuntu Jammy): status In Progress Fix Committed
2022-08-19 17:22:21 Brian Murray bug added subscriber Ubuntu Stable Release Updates Team
2022-08-19 17:22:24 Brian Murray bug added subscriber SRU Verification
2022-08-19 17:22:29 Brian Murray tags architecture-s39064 bugnameltc-199023 jammy kinetic severity-high targetmilestone-inin2210 architecture-s39064 bugnameltc-199023 jammy kinetic severity-high targetmilestone-inin2210 verification-needed verification-needed-jammy
2022-08-19 17:39:16 Frank Heimes ubuntu-z-systems: status In Progress Fix Committed
2022-09-13 16:51:32 Frank Heimes tags architecture-s39064 bugnameltc-199023 jammy kinetic severity-high targetmilestone-inin2210 verification-needed verification-needed-jammy architecture-s39064 bugnameltc-199023 jammy kinetic severity-high targetmilestone-inin2210 verification-done verification-done-jammy
2022-09-13 19:30:25 Launchpad Janitor qclib (Ubuntu Jammy): status Fix Committed Fix Released
2022-09-13 19:30:28 Brian Murray removed subscriber Ubuntu Stable Release Updates Team
2022-09-13 19:40:52 Frank Heimes ubuntu-z-systems: status Fix Committed Fix Released